Abstract:
    The method comprises: 1) generating high capacity of digital watermarking signals 2) pre-processing the original image to be embedded with the watermark; 3) embedding watermark information; 4) processing the watermark image before extracting the watermark; 5) extracting the watermark; 6) enhancing the image watermark information. The invention features the following: 1) embedding binary image high capacity information that enhances the identifiability of watermark information; 2) having strong robustness of anti-print and anti-scanning that can be used in anti-fake of all certificates and prints; using Hausdorff-based distance geometric correction process, which can effectively correct all geometric attack to watermark signal in the print and scanning process such as rotation, scaling and translation.
